OPD Officer-Involved Shooting Investigated in Orlando

The Orlando Police Department is investigating an officer-involved shooting at Luminary Green Park that occurred on August 22nd near West Amelia Street and Chatham Avenue.




At approximately 3:40am, officers responded to a disturbance between roommates. While talking with the roommates involved in the dispute, a white male in his 40s, who appeared to be sleeping in Luminary Green Park, charged at officers with an edged weapon, later identified as a pair of scissors.

According to local law enforcement, while charging at officers, the suspect made a slashing motion with the scissors. Officers gave multiple commands for the suspect to drop the weapon. However, the suspect refused to obey their commands and continued to come at the officers. When the suspect failed to comply, he was shot. He died at the scene.

OPD said this was a completely unprovoked attack, and the officers had no prior contact with the suspect. We want to be clear, the suspect involved in this shooting was not involved in the initial dispute between roommates.




According to OPD, the suspect has a criminal history including burglary with assault and battery, grand theft, and possession of meth.

The officers involved in this shooting were not injured and have been placed on administrative leave, which is standard procedure. As with all officer-involved shootings, FDLE will conduct an independent review of the incident, followed by the State Attorney’s office.
